People seem to underestimate how efficient regular power lines are.
The continent-spanning european power grid has a total transmission loss of about 6% using 19th century technology (transformers and copper wires). Modern high voltage DC lines can perform even better. The main limitation seems to be that people don't want to have power lines in their back yard. Not something that superconductors are going to sove. |
